+/** @defgroup PWR_PVD_detection_level Power Voltage Detector Level selection
+ * @note Refer datasheet for selection voltage value
+ * @{
+ */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_0 (0x00000000U)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.0 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_1 ( PWR_CR2_PLS_0)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.2 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_2 ( PWR_CR2_PLS_1 )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.4 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_3 ( PWR_CR2_PLS_1 | PWR_CR2_PLS_0)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.5 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_4 (PWR_CR2_PLS_2 )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.6 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_5 (PWR_CR2_PLS_2 | PWR_CR2_PLS_0)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.8 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_6 (PWR_CR2_PLS_2 | PWR_CR2_PLS_1 ) /*!< PVD threshold around 2.9 V */
+#define PWR_PVDLEVEL_7 (PWR_CR2_PLS_2 | PWR_CR2_PLS_1 | PWR_CR2_PLS_0) /*!< External input analog voltage (compared internally to VREFINT) */
+/**
+ * @}
+ */
+
+/** @defgroup PWR_PVD_Mode PWR PVD interrupt and event mode
+ * @{
+ */
+/* Note: On STM32WB series, power PVD event is not available on AIEC lines */
+/* (only interruption is available through AIEC line 16). */
+#define PWR_PVD_MODE_NORMAL (0x00000000U) /*!< Basic mode is used */
+
+#define PWR_PVD_MODE_IT_RISING (PVD_MODE_IT | PVD_RISING_EDGE) /*!< External Interrupt Mode with Rising edge trigger detection */
+#define PWR_PVD_MODE_IT_FALLING (PVD_MODE_IT | PVD_FALLING_EDGE) /*!< External Interrupt Mode with Falling edge trigger detection */
+#define PWR_PVD_MODE_IT_RISING_FALLING (PVD_MODE_IT | PVD_RISING_FALLING_EDGE) /*!< External Interrupt Mode with Rising/Falling edge trigger detection */
+/**
+ * @}
+ */
+
+/* Note: On STM32WB series, power PVD event is not available on AIEC lines */
+/* (only interruption is available through AIEC line 16). */
+
+/** @defgroup PWR_Low_Power_Mode_Selection PWR Low Power Mode Selection
+ * @{
+ */
+#define PWR_LOWPOWERMODE_STOP0 (0x00000000u) /*!< Stop 0: stop mode with main regulator */
+#define PWR_LOWPOWERMODE_STOP1 (PWR_CR1_LPMS_0) /*!< Stop 1: stop mode with low power regulator */
+#if defined(PWR_SUPPORT_STOP2)
+#define PWR_LOWPOWERMODE_STOP2 (PWR_CR1_LPMS_1) /*!< Stop 2: stop mode with low power regulator and VDD12I interruptible digital core domain supply OFF (less peripherals activated than low power mode stop 1 to reduce power consumption)*/
+#endif /* PWR_SUPPORT_STOP2 */
+#define PWR_LOWPOWERMODE_STANDBY (PWR_CR1_LPMS_0 | PWR_CR1_LPMS_1) /*!< Standby mode */
+#define PWR_LOWPOWERMODE_SHUTDOWN (PWR_CR1_LPMS_2) /*!< Shutdown mode */
+/**
+ * @}
+ */

+/** @brief Check whether or not a specific PWR flag is set.
+ * @param __FLAG__ specifies the flag to check.
+ * This parameter can be one of the following values:
+ *
+ * /--------------------------------SR1-------------------------------/
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UF1 Wake Up Flag 1. Indicates that a wakeup event
+ * was received from the WKUP pin 1.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UF2 Wake Up Flag 2. Indicates that a wakeup event
+ * was received from the WKUP pin 2.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UF3 Wake Up Flag 3. Indicates that a wakeup event
+ * was received from the WKUP pin 3.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UF4 Wake Up Flag 4. Indicates that a wakeup event
+ * was received from the WKUP pin 4.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UF5 Wake Up Flag 5. Indicates that a wakeup event
+ * was received from the WKUP pin 5.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_BHWF BLE_Host WakeUp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_FRCBYPI SMPS Forced in Bypass Interrupt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_RFPHASEI Radio Phase Interrupt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_BLEACTI BLE Activity Interrupt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_802ACTI 802.15.4 Activity Interrupt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_HOLDC2I CPU2 on-Hold Interrupt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_WUFI Wake-Up Flag Internal. Set when a wakeup is detected on
+ * the internal wakeup line.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_SMPSRDYF SMPS Ready Flag
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_SMPSBYPF SMPS Bypass Flag
+ *
+ * /--------------------------------SR2-------------------------------/
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_REGLPS Low Power Regulator Started. Indicates whether or not the
+ * low-power regulator is ready.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_REGLPF Low Power Regulator Flag. Indicates whether the
+ * regulator is ready in main mode or is in low-power mode.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_VOSF Voltage Scaling Flag. Indicates whether the regulator is ready
+ * in the selected voltage range or is still changing to the required voltage level.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_PVDO Power Voltage Detector Output. Indicates whether VDD voltage is
+ * below or above the selected PVD threshold.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_PVMO1 Peripheral Voltage Monitoring Output 1. Indicates whether VDDUSB voltage is
+ * is below or above PVM1 threshold (applicable when USB feature is supported).
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_PVMO3 Peripheral Voltage Monitoring Output 3. Indicates whether VDDA voltage is
+ * is below or above PVM3 threshold.
+ *
+ * /----------------------------EXTSCR--------------------------/
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_STOP System Stop Flag for CPU1.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_SB System Standby Flag for CPU1.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_C2STOP System Stop Flag for CPU2.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_C2SB System Standby Flag for CPU2.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_CRITICAL_RF_PHASE Critical radio system phase flag.
+ *
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_C1DEEPSLEEP CPU1 DeepSleep Flag.
+ * @arg @ref PWR_FLAG_C2DEEPSLEEP CPU2 DeepSleep Flag.
+ *
+ * @retval The new state of __FLAG__ (TRUE or FALSE).
+ */
+#define __HAL_PWR_GET_FLAG(__FLAG__) ((((__FLAG__) & PWR_FLAG_REG_MASK) == PWR_FLAG_REG_SR1) ? \
+ ( \
+ PWR->SR1 & (1UL << ((__FLAG__) & 31UL)) \
+ ) \
+ : \
+ ( \
+ (((__FLAG__) & PWR_FLAG_REG_MASK) == PWR_FLAG_REG_SR2) ? \
+ ( \
+ PWR->SR2 & (1UL << ((__FLAG__) & 31UL)) \
+ ) \
+ : \
+ ( \
+ PWR->EXTSCR & (1UL << ((__FLAG__) & 31UL)) \
+ ) \
+ ) \
+ )
